2

Remote Device Driver Developer Jobs in California

Experience with device management integration in a mobile or IoT context: policy enforcement, remote configuration, and status reporting over cellular. * Strong API design and integration engineering ...

Senior DevOps Engineer

Sacramento, CA · Remote

$138K - $178K/yr

... Device Interaction and Automation Layer). We\'re also actively building Gluware.ai and Gluware ... Gluware is headquartered in Sacramento CA but our workforce is predominantly remote. This role is ...

Senior DevOps Engineer

Sacramento, CA · Remote

$138K - $178K/yr

... DIAL (our Device Interaction and Automation Layer). We're also actively building Gluware.ai and ... Gluware is headquartered in Sacramento CA but our workforce is predominantly remote. This role is ...

San Francisco Bay Area Preferred, will consider Remote Key Responsibilities * Netskope Platform ... Build policies using Netskope context such as user, group, app, instance, activity, device posture ...

Lead Quality Engineer

Redwood City, CA · On-site +1

$120K - $165K/yr

Responsible for investigational device development, clinical performance, and lifecycle management ... Additionally, for remote roles open to individuals in unincorporated Los Angeles - including remote ...

Helpdesk Technician

Los Angeles, CA · Remote

$21.50 - $29/hr

Varsity is hiring for a Helpdesk Technician to join our Remote Support team. The ideal candidate ... Troubleshoot and resolve device, software, and connectivity issues. * Assist with setup and ...

Helpdesk Technician

Los Angeles, CA · On-site +1

$21.50 - $29/hr

Varsity is hiring for a Helpdesk Technician to join our Remote Support team. The ideal candidate ... Troubleshoot and resolve device, software, and connectivity issues. * Assist with setup and ...

MMIC Design Engineer

Menlo Park, CA · On-site +1

$160K - $250K/yr

We are seeking a highly experienced THz IC Design Engineer to join our growing team. In this role ... Experience with high speed device technologies. * Understanding tradeoff at the device level for ...

We are seeking a highly experienced THz IC Design Engineer to join our growing team. In this role ... Experience with high speed device technologies. * Understanding tradeoff at the device level for ...

EDI Developer

Rancho Santa Margarita, CA · On-site +1

$90K - $140K/yr

Applied Medical is a new generation medical device company with a proven business model and ... Offer after-hours remote support for critical EDI production operations as needed. Success in This ...

next page

Showing results 1-20

Remote Device Driver Developer information

What are Remote Device Driver Developers?

Remote Device Driver Developers are software engineers who specialize in creating, testing, and maintaining device drivers while working from a remote location. Device drivers are programs that allow the operating system and software applications to communicate with hardware devices such as printers, network cards, and storage devices. These developers need a strong understanding of hardware interfaces, operating systems, and programming languages like C or C++. Working remotely, they use collaborative tools to coordinate with hardware engineers, QA testers, and other developers. Their work ensures that hardware components function properly and efficiently with different computer systems.

What are the key skills and qualifications needed to thrive as a Remote Device Driver Developer, and why are they important?

To thrive as a Remote Device Driver Developer, you need strong expertise in systems programming, operating system internals, and hardware-software interaction, typically supported by a degree in computer science or a related field. Experience with C/C++, kernel development, version control systems like Git, and familiarity with debugging tools are commonly required, along with certifications such as Linux Foundation Certified Engineer if working with Linux drivers. Excellent problem-solving skills, attention to detail, and clear remote communication abilities are crucial soft skills for excelling in distributed teams. These competencies ensure the reliable development and maintenance of low-level software that enables seamless hardware functionality, even in remote work environments.

What are some common challenges faced by remote device driver developers, and how can they be effectively managed?

Remote device driver developers often encounter challenges such as limited access to physical hardware for testing, communication barriers with cross-functional teams, and troubleshooting issues that are difficult to reproduce remotely. These can be effectively managed by using robust hardware emulation tools, establishing clear documentation and communication channels, and collaborating closely with quality assurance and hardware teams. Regular virtual meetings and remote debugging tools also help ensure smooth development and integration processes.
What are the most commonly searched types of Device Driver Developer jobs in California? The most popular types of Device Driver Developer jobs in California are:
What are popular job titles related to Remote Device Driver Developer jobs in California? For Remote Device Driver Developer jobs in California, the most frequently searched job titles are:
What job categories do people searching Remote Device Driver Developer jobs in California look for? The top searched job categories for Remote Device Driver Developer jobs in California are:
What cities in California are hiring for Remote Device Driver Developer jobs? Cities in California with the most Remote Device Driver Developer job openings:

Software Integration Lead - 5G CORE

E-Space

Saratoga, CA • Remote

$180K - $220K/yr

Full-time

Medical, PTO

Posted 3 days ago


Job description

Ready to make connectivity from space universally accessible, secure and actionable? Then you've come to the right place!

E-Space is bridging Earth and space to enable hyper-scaled deployments of Internet of Things (IoT) solutions and services. We are building a highly-advanced low Earth orbit (LEO) space system that will fundamentally change the design, economics, manufacturing and service delivery associated with traditional satellite and terrestrial IoT systems.

We're intentional, we're unapologetically curious and we're 100% committed to innovate space-based communications and deliver actionable intelligence that will expand global economies, protect space and our planet and enhance our overall quality of life.

We are looking for a Software Integration Lead to own the integration of back-end subscriber and business support systems with E-Space's 5G Core network. This is a hands-on technical leadership role sitting at the boundary between the core network and the systems that provision, manage, and bill subscribers - SIM and eSIM provisioning, CRM, billing and charging, and device management. You will own the interface contracts, drive integration delivery, and ensure these systems interoperate correctly with core network functions end-to-end, spanning satellite and ground environments.

What you will do:
  • Own the integration architecture and delivery for back-end systems that interface directly with the 5G Core: SIM/eSIM provisioning, CRM, billing and online/offline charging, and device management.
  • Define and implement the integration between SIM and eSIM provisioning infrastructure and core subscriber management - including subscriber profile delivery, remote SIM provisioning workflows, and profile lifecycle management across satellite and ground.
  • Design and own the interface between CRM and the core network: subscriber record synchronisation, service entitlement and quota management, and real-time event delivery for customer-facing workflows.
  • Lead integration of the billing and charging stack with the core charging interfaces - CDR generation and delivery, online charging authorization flows, and reconciliation between core charging events and BSS billing records.
  • Integrate device management capabilities with core network functions, including device policy enforcement, configuration delivery, and status signalling across the satellite link.
  • Define interface contracts (API specifications, data models, event schemas) at each BSS/OSS-to-core boundary; maintain them as the engineering source of truth shared across core software and back-end platform teams.
  • Build and maintain integration test harnesses for each BSS/OSS-to-core interface; drive automation and define acceptance criteria for every interface at each release milestone.
  • Own defect triage and root-cause analysis for integration failures at BSS/OSS-to-core boundaries; coordinate resolution across core software and back-end platform engineering teams.
  • Lead and mentor a small integration engineering team (2-4 engineers); set delivery cadence and engineering quality standards.
What you bring to this role:
  • Bachelor's or Master's degree in Computer Science, Software Engineering, Electrical/Computer Engineering, or a related field.
  • 12+ years of software engineering experience, with significant focus on BSS/OSS integration with mobile core networks.
  • Strong understanding of 5G Core subscriber management and the interfaces that connect BSS/OSS systems to the core - authentication, session management, policy, and charging.
  • Hands-on experience integrating SIM or eSIM provisioning infrastructure (SM-DP+, SM-SR, or equivalent) with mobile core subscriber management systems.
  • Experience integrating CRM and billing platforms with telecom core networks: service provisioning APIs, online/offline charging interfaces, CDR delivery, and event-driven subscriber data updates.
  • Experience with device management integration in a mobile or IoT context: policy enforcement, remote configuration, and status reporting over cellular.
  • Strong API design and integration engineering skills: REST and event-driven interface specification, data model design, and integration test automation.
  • Experience leading small software integration teams with clear API contract discipline and release tracking.
Bonus points for the following:
  • Experience with eSIM and remote SIM provisioning in a satellite or IoT connectivity context.
  • Background in MVNO BSS/OSS integration: multi-PLMN subscriber management, roaming data exchange, or MVNO billing stack integration.
  • Familiarity with cloud-native core deployment and how containerised network functions affect BSS/OSS integration patterns.
  • Experience in a startup or fast-paced R&D environment where integration scope expands rapidly.
  • Prior work with government or defence connectivity platforms with BSS/OSS integration requirements.
$180,000 - $220,000 a year

This is a full time, exempt position, based out of our Saratoga, CA office. 
 
The total compensation packaged will be determined by various factors such as your relevant job-related knowledge, skills, and experience. 
 
We are redefining how satellites are designed, manufactured and used-so we're looking for candidates with passion, deep knowledge and direct experience on LEO satellite component development, design and in-orbit activities. If that's your experience - then we'll be immediately wow-ed.
 
E-Space is not currently able to provide employment sponsorship for candidates who do not hold work authorization for the location of this role.  The Company is not currently able to provide employment sponsorship for candidates who do not hold work authorization for the location of this role.

Why E-Space is right for you:

As a member of our team, you will play a crucial role in driving our success.  Our team members have a strong sense of dedication and responsibility; this includes a strong commitment to our mission to create an entirely new suite of global capabilities to improve lives, business efficiencies and build a smarter planet. This means that there will be times when extra hours, including nights and weekends, may be needed to meet critical deadlines and mission goals.  In return, we offer a dynamic work environment with opportunities for professional growth and development and the chance to make a meaningful impact in a high-growth industry.  

We want you to make the most of your journey at E-Space. That's why we support and invest in the physical, emotional and financial well-being of our team members and their families. Some of what you can expect when working at E-Space:

An opportunity to really make a difference
Sustainability at our core
Fair and honest workplace
Innovative thinking is encouraged
Competitive salaries
Continuous learning and development
Health and wellness care options
Financial solutions for the future
Optional legal services (US only)
Paid holidays
Paid time off

We may use artificial intelligence (AI) tools to support parts of the hiring process, such as reviewing applications, analyzing resumes, or assessing responses and identifying potential inconsistencies or verification signals in application materials based on available information. These tools assist our recruitment team but do not replace human judgment. Final hiring decisions are ultimately made by humans. If you would like more information about how your data is processed, please contact us.
apply for this job